About Ispaghula (Psyllium) Seed Allergy Test
This IgE antibody allergy test uses a blood sample to determine if you are allergic to the Ispaghula (Psyllium) Seed.
The Ispaghula (Psyllium) Seed Allergy Test is a laboratory test. Your health care provider can explain what it measures and whether it is appropriate for your situation.
